I have taken class that were supposed to be a deeper dive into anatomy & physiology while in medical school, yet this one seems to require more material in a shorter time frame. My biggest issue though is that for the test taking we are not able to go back to a question, once it’s answered there is no changing it. This could be for the better perhaps, but it also does not allow you to move forward without an answer so you are forced to pick an answer to move on. It seems that this is an available option on examplify, but it is not available due to our teachers decision. Because we had a “mock exam” before our first exam and the program showed how to do backtracking. So I went into the first exam thinking it would be available. And for the 2nd lecture exam it showed “time left” but it didn’t not coincided with what the teacher had as a limit. The difference was 25 min which is a substantial amount of time when taking a 50-60 question exam.
